0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

PLC与传感器间的五种通信方式

要长高 来源:中国ic网 2023-10-05 16:30 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

PLC(可编程逻辑控制器)是一种专门用于工业自动化控制的设备,用于控制和监控机器和过程。传感器是用于检测和测量物理量的设备,例如温度、压力、湿度等。PLC与传感器之间的通信非常重要,因为它们共同协作来实现自动化控制。

PLC与传感器之间的通信可以通过多种方式实现,下面将介绍几种常见的通信方式。

1、模拟量输入:一些传感器输出的是模拟信号,例如0-10V或4-20mA,PLC可以通过模拟量输入模块来读取这些信号。模拟量输入模块将模拟信号转换为数字信号,PLC可以读取并进行处理。

2、数字量输入:一些传感器输出的是数字信号,例如开关信号或脉冲信号,PLC可以通过数字量输入模块来读取这些信号。数字量输入模块可以读取开关的状态(开或关)或者脉冲的数量,并将其转换为PLC可以理解的格式。

3、通信接口:一些传感器具有通信接口,例如RS485、Modbus、Profibus等。PLC可以通过相应的通信模块与这些传感器进行通信。通信模块将传感器的数据通过特定的通信协议传输给PLC,PLC可以解析这些数据并进行相应的处理。

4、总线系统:一些传感器可以通过总线系统与PLC进行通信,例如CAN总线、Ethernet、DeviceNet等。PLC可以通过总线接口模块连接到总线系统,与传感器进行通信。总线系统可以同时连接多个传感器,PLC可以通过地址和命令来选择和读取相应的传感器数据。

无论使用哪种通信方式,PLC需要配置相应的输入模块或接口模块来与传感器进行通信。PLC还需要编写相应的程序来读取和处理传感器数据。通常,PLC的编程软件提供了一些特定的指令和函数来实现与传感器的通信,开发人员可以根据具体的需求使用这些指令和函数来编写程序。

此外,PLC还可以通过输出模块或接口模块向传感器发送控制信号,实现对传感器的控制。例如,PLC可以通过输出模块向传感器发送开关信号,控制传感器的开关状态;或者通过通信接口向传感器发送配置命令,设置传感器的参数。

总之,PLC与传感器之间的通信是实现工业自动化控制的关键步骤,可以通过模拟量输入、数字量输入、通信接口、总线系统等方式实现。PLC需要配置相应的输入模块或接口模块,并编写相应的程序来读取和处理传感器数据。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 传感器
    +关注

    关注

    2577

    文章

    55444

    浏览量

    793724
  • plc
    plc
    +关注

    关注

    5052

    文章

    14771

    浏览量

    488356
  • 通信
    +关注

    关注

    18

    文章

    6445

    浏览量

    140243
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    什么是力觉传感器

    ,就叫几维传感器。最常见的是一维、三维和六维,二维和维由于性价比不高、应用场景特殊,所以很少见。 什么是力觉传感器? 力觉传感器是一能“
    的头像 发表于 04-08 11:43 226次阅读

    西门子S7-1200和S7-1500 PLC系列模拟量传感器怎么接线

    西门子S7-1200和S7-1500PLC系列模拟量传感器怎么接线,现场看到的4线制,3线制,2线制模拟量传感器接线。
    的头像 发表于 03-06 13:57 740次阅读
    西门子S7-1200和S7-1500 <b class='flag-5'>PLC</b>系列模拟量<b class='flag-5'>传感器</b>怎么接线

    BLDC无位置传感器控制方式介绍

    BLDC根据转子的位置进行换向控制,而转子位置要靠位置传感器获取,那么这期就为大家介绍BLDC的无位置传感器控制方式
    的头像 发表于 12-30 07:55 1.3w次阅读
    BLDC无位置<b class='flag-5'>传感器</b>控制<b class='flag-5'>方式</b>介绍

    PLC联网有什么通信设备

    模块 :PLC传统有线通信的核心设备,适用于短距离数据传输。RS232模块支持点对点通信,RS485模块则支持多设备组网,通过总线结构实现PLC
    的头像 发表于 11-10 17:54 968次阅读

    串口通信有哪些方式

    的分类及说明: 一、按通信方向分类 单工(Simplex) 特点:数据仅沿一个方向传输,无法反向。 应用:如传感器向主机发送数据(单向读取)。 示例:简单的温度传感器通过串口发送数据到主机。 半双工(Half-Duplex) 特
    的头像 发表于 09-28 18:02 1271次阅读

    传感器如何实现数据采集联网通信

    传感器实现数据采集与联网通信是一个涉及硬件设计、协议选择、数据处理和云平台集成的系统化过程。其核心目标是将传感器采集的物理量(如温度、湿度、压力等)转换为数字信号,并通过有线或无线方式
    的头像 发表于 09-23 17:30 1354次阅读

    变频中电压传感器和高精度电流传感器应用推荐

    前言:变频是一设备,输出任意希望的频率值。变频通常以交-直-交的方式来实现,电压、电流传感器在变频里是个重要的“感知器官”功能,能实时
    的头像 发表于 09-10 10:09 1309次阅读
    变频<b class='flag-5'>器</b>中电压<b class='flag-5'>传感器</b>和高精度电流<b class='flag-5'>传感器</b>应用推荐

    颜色传感器的检测原理和应用实例

    颜色传感器是一能够感知光线的传感器(光电传感器、光传感器的一)。
    的头像 发表于 09-04 17:13 3692次阅读
    颜色<b class='flag-5'>传感器</b>的检测原理和应用实例

    雷达传感器和红外传感器的区别

    不同的两实现方式,下面小编带大家一起了解雷达传感器和红外传感器的区别。​   雷达传感器的工作原理: 以WT4101A-C01雷达
    的头像 发表于 08-28 17:48 1394次阅读

    什么是照度传感器和接近传感器

    近年来,照度传感器和接近传感器在我们身边各类设备中的应用越来越广泛。除了单独使用照度传感器和接近传感器外,将这些传感器组合使用的情况也在不断
    的头像 发表于 08-22 14:46 3078次阅读
    什么是照度<b class='flag-5'>传感器</b>和接近<b class='flag-5'>传感器</b>

    带通滤波在无位置传感器转子检测中的应用

    摘 要:论文研究了一直流无刷电机的无位置传感器的转子位置的硬件电路检测方法。结合传统“反电动势\"方法,分析并设计了一新的带通滤波延时检测电路。该电路不仅可以抑制高频分量和消除直
    发表于 08-04 14:56

    如何选择激光位移传感器

    激光位移传感器是采用激光进行高精度位移(距离)测量的一传感器,与传统测量方式相比,激光位移传感器因其高精度、非接触且快速测量等优势在工业中
    的头像 发表于 07-01 09:48 1233次阅读
    如何选择激光位移<b class='flag-5'>传感器</b>

    阀门拉手传感器,Ethernetip转canopen网关解决AB-PLC的冷门用法

    拉手传感器通信,但AB-PLC原生不支持CANopen协议。通过EtherNet/IP转CANopen网关,如稳联技术,VLINE,GWBX),我们实现了高效协议转换: 1. **硬件配置** - 网关作为从
    的头像 发表于 06-21 13:46 946次阅读
    阀门拉手<b class='flag-5'>传感器</b>,Ethernetip转canopen网关解决AB-<b class='flag-5'>PLC</b>的冷门用法

    如何实现CX变频PLC通信

    实现CX变频PLC通信是工业自动化领域中的常见需求,其核心在于协议匹配、硬件连接和参数配置。以下从技术原理、实施步骤及常见问题解决三个方面展开详细说明。 一、
    的头像 发表于 06-07 17:53 1364次阅读
    如何实现CX变频<b class='flag-5'>器</b>与<b class='flag-5'>PLC</b><b class='flag-5'>间</b>的<b class='flag-5'>通信</b>?

    可以通过 slavefifo 接口建立 FX3 和传感器通信吗?

    需要在CYUSB2014和AR0144c之间建立通信。 我们不采用 UVC 框架。 我们可以通过 slavefifo 接口建立 FX3 和传感器通信吗? 我已将“slfifosync”项目文件视为
    发表于 05-19 08:30